While everyone knows about Mars and Venus, that doesnt explain why a simple conversation can blow up or leave one feeling hurt, not knowing what to do differently. Finally, there is a dictionary that does just that, Why Dont You Understand? A Gender Relationship Dictionary.

Let me put this in perspective.

If I said to you, We need to rabbit, or Please, keep your hair on, or Do you read the daily agony aunt? youd probably think I had lost my screws. Actually, Ive got them all and they are in tight. These sentences are perfectly good, understandable English British English, that is.

Although we speak English, just like the British, we still need a translation:

1Rabbit: talk

2Keep your hair on = calm down

3Daily agony aunt = advice column

We expect English words to be different in England; however, we do not notice how they differ here in the U.S., according to gender.

To help with translations, theres a dictionary for British English. And now there is one for men and women.

Heres a sampling of four words that have different meanings to men than to women.

Intimacy

When men refer to intimacy, they mean making love. Such as, Lets be intimate tonight. Or, My wife hasnt been intimate with me for 6 weeks.

When women use the word, they refer to the emotional connection between a man and a woman, including sharing feelings.

Women need to feel close before wanting to make love, and men feel close through the act of making love. While both want to take the same intimacy trip, its like shes waiting at the airport while hes at the train station.

Purpose of conversation

The underpinning of relationships is communication, yet the very purpose of conversation is different for men than for women.

For men, conversation is to exchange or get information, to answer questions. Its factual.

For women, conversation is to connect, to relate to the other person.

Even with a simple conversation like a woman sharing a problem with a friend can erupt into an argument.

For the man, if her comments do not invite a response from him, he may remain silent, assuming if she wanted to share more, she would.

For the woman, his not responding says he doesnt care.

Silence

In addition to the above, theres another gender difference to the word silence.

Men often feel the most intimate with a woman when they are sitting quietly (silently) in the same room, each one in a separate activity. Or, sitting together watching tv.

For women, silence may not be a sign of closeness. If a man is not talking with them, they may feel he does not care. Watching TV requires no interaction, so it may not have the same meaning of closeness to a woman.

Silence, then, means closeness to a man, but abandonment or not caring to a woman.

Advice

When a man gives advice, he is showing his affection, his caring. Advice is a means of letting the woman know he thinks about her and what he can give to or do for her.

For a woman, when a man gives (unsolicited) advice, it is as if he is telling her she is stupid and cant figure out what she should do on her own. She may also feel he is talking down to her, treating her like a child.
